E-Ink News Daily

Back to list

A Randomized Scheduler with Probabilistic Guarantees of Finding Bugs

This Microsoft Research paper presents a randomized scheduler with probabilistic guarantees for detecting concurrency bugs. The approach uses probabilistic analysis to systematically explore thread interleavings and provide statistical confidence in bug detection. The technique shows promise for improving the reliability of concurrent software systems.

Background

Concurrency bugs are notoriously difficult to detect and reproduce due to the non-deterministic nature of thread scheduling. Traditional testing methods often struggle to uncover these issues reliably.

Source
Lobsters
Published
May 9, 2026 at 12:27 PM
Score
7.0 / 10